file-type

掌握vscode-css-languageserver-bin:VSCode CSS语言服务快速部署

下载需积分: 34 | 7KB | 更新于2025-04-14 | 191 浏览量 | 0 下载量 举报 收藏
download 立即下载
根据提供的信息,我们可以从中提取出以下与IT技术相关知识点: 1. **VSCode树和npm发布**: - VSCode(Visual Studio Code)是一个流行的代码编辑器,由微软开发,支持多种编程语言,并且具有丰富的扩展生态。 - npm(Node Package Manager)是一个用于管理JavaScript项目的软件包管理器,允许开发者在项目中安装和管理代码库和依赖。 - 本文提及的“vscode-css-languageserver-bin”是一个专门处理CSS语言特性的语言服务器的二进制版本。这个服务器被VSCode用来为CSS代码提供智能提示、代码分析、错误检查等功能。 2. **产品特点**: - **CSS支持**:CSS(层叠样式表)是网页制作中使用的重要技术,用于描述网页的外观和格式。语言服务器提供了对CSS语法的支持和特性分析。 - **SASS支持**:SASS是一种流行的CSS预处理器,它扩展了CSS的功能,允许使用变量、嵌套规则、混合等特性,提高CSS的可维护性和复用性。该语言服务器也提供了SASS文件的支持。 - **LESS支持**:LESS也是一种CSS预处理器,类似于SASS,提供了额外的功能来增强CSS开发。 - **代码操作**:提供了诸如自动重命名CSS属性等代码操作功能,以帮助开发者维护样式表的整洁和一致性。 - **验证**:能够对CSS和SASS/LESS代码进行语法检查,识别并提示语法错误和潜在的问题。 - **悬停工具提示、定义、悬停和参考提供商**:这些功能提供了在编码时,当鼠标悬停在某个CSS属性或类上时,显示相关信息的提示。 - **文件符号和突出显示**:允许用户在编辑器中快速跳转到文件中的特定符号(如类名、ID等),并且可以对这些符号进行高亮显示。 - **重命名符号**:允许开发者重命名CSS中的符号,并自动更新所有相关的引用。 3. **入门和先决条件**: - 为了在本地计算机上运行和测试项目的副本,必须先安装npm。在安装npm之后,可以通过全局安装命令`npm install --global`来安装语言服务器。 - 文档提及的部署说明没有详细描述,但通常部署涉及到将开发完成的项目部署到生产环境中。 4. **相关技术标签**: - **css**:代表层叠样式表,是网页设计的核心技术之一。 - **sass**:指SASS语言,CSS的预处理器。 - **less**:指LESS语言,另一种CSS预处理器。 - **language-server**:指语言服务器协议(Language Server Protocol),是一个能让编程语言编辑器和IDE与语言相关服务交互的协议。 - **vscode**:指的是Visual Studio Code编辑器。 - **SassJavaScript**:可能是文档错误或者一个错误的标签,因为通常不会这样合并“Sass”和“JavaScript”两个技术。 5. **关于文件压缩包的命名**: - 提及的文件名称“vscode-css-languageserver-bin-master”表明这可能是一个版本控制系统的主分支(master)的源代码压缩包。 总结来说,文档描述了一个专门针对CSS,SASS和LESS的VSCode插件,这个插件是基于“language-server”协议的,旨在为VSCode用户提供更加智能和便捷的CSS编码体验。它支持语法高亮、代码补全、错误检测等功能,并能够处理多种CSS相关的文件格式。使用该插件前,用户需要确保计算机上已经安装了npm。

相关推荐